What viewpoint was common among Anti-Federalists?

History
1 answer:
Goryan [66]3 years ago
3 0

Answer:

Many Anti-Federalists preferred a weak central government because they equated a strong government with British tyranny. Others wanted to encourage democracy and feared a strong government that would be dominated by the wealthy. They felt that the states were giving up too much power to the new federal government.

during the yuan dynasty the mongols suspended the chinese civil service examination system. what important effect did this have
Amanda [17]

Answer: The Yuan dynasty kept the Chinese bureaucracy and many traditions of the Chinese court. However, it suspended the civil service exams, took power away from the scholar-officials, and lowered the status of northern and southern Chinese.
